Biography

Hadaiyah Bey, known professionally as Yaya Bey, was born on 4 August 1990 in New York City and emerged as a soul‑influenced R&B singer. Her first public appearance came in 2016 with the EP The Many Alter Egos of Trill’eta Brown, followed by This Too… (2019) and Madison Tapes (2020). In 2021 she signed with Big Dada Recordings and released the EP The Things I Can't Take with Me; the next year she issued the album Remember Your North Star, produced largely by herself, which received a “Best New Music” designation from Pitchfork. Subsequent releases include the remix album Career Day (2024) and Do It Afraid (2025). In 2026 she issued the single "Blue", followed by the album Fidelity.
